Interpretation summary
Generated evidence synthesis
1
PM2 (moderate): The variant is absent from gnomAD v2.1, gnomAD v4.1, and gnomAD-Canada, with an allele frequency of 0% in all queried population databases, supporting moderate evidence for pathogenicity.
2
BP1 (supporting benign): RB1 is a gene in which >80% of pathogenic germline variants are truncating, and missense variants account for only 9.2% of pathogenic variants (PMID:42461076). This missense variant occurs in a gene where the primary disease mechanism is loss of function through null alleles.
3
BP4 (supporting benign): Multiple lines of computational evidence — REVEL score 0.272, BayesDel score -0.129, and SpliceAI max delta 0.01 — converge on a non-deleterious prediction, providing supporting evidence against pathogenicity.
4
Classification: Uncertain Significance (VUS). There is conflicting evidence: PM2 (moderate pathogenicity) from complete absence in population databases is offset by BP1 (supporting benign) and BP4 (supporting benign). The two supporting benign criteria do not reach the 'likely benign' threshold in the presence of a moderate pathogenic criterion. Additional evidence — particularly functional studies, segregation data, or clinical case reports — is needed to resolve this variant's clinical significance.
Final determination: Generic ACMG/AMP 2015 fallback rules do not meet benign, likely benign, likely pathogenic, or pathogenic combination thresholds, so the variant is classified as Variant of Uncertain Significance.
ACMG/AMP criteria review
Criteria shown when status is available
All criteria require review: For research and educational purposes only.
Criterion Status Rationale Evidence used
PVS1 N/A Missense variant (c.743G>C, p.Gly248Ala); does not fall into the generic PVS1 null-variant buckets of nonsense, frameshift, or canonical ±1,2 splice consensus variants per ClinGen SVI PVS1 recommendations (PMC6185798).

PS1 Not met No known pathogenic variant affecting the same amino acid (Gly248) via a different nucleotide change has been identified. The variant is absent from ClinVar and no literature reports a pathogenic comparator at this residue.

PS2 Not met No de novo data available; both paternal and maternal confirmation were not assessed. No family-based or parent-of-origin testing data are present for this case.
PS3 Not met No variant-specific functional data available. OncoKB reports Unknown Oncogenic Effect with no reviewed functional evidence for G248A. No publication identified with experimental characterization of this variant or a systematically characterized range that includes residue 248.

PS4 Not met No case-control data or statistical enrichment data available for this variant in affected individuals versus controls.
PS5 N/A PS5 is only applicable for recessive disorders (biallelic variant in trans with a known pathogenic variant). RB1-associated disease follows autosomal dominant inheritance.
PM1 Not met Residue Gly248 is located in the N-terminal region of RB1, outside the well-characterized Pocket A and Pocket B domains. Cancerhotspots.org does not identify this residue as a statistically significant hotspot. Published RB1 variant landscape data (PMID:42461076) shows that pathogenic missense variants are concentrated in Pocket B, not the N-terminal region. The N-terminal domain accumulates primarily nonsense, not missense, pathogenic variants.
PM2 Met This variant is absent from gnomAD v2.1, gnomAD v4.1, and gnomAD-Canada v1.0, with a population allele frequency of 0%. This meets the PM2 threshold for absence from large population databases (AF < 0.1% under non-VCEP generic ACMG rules).

PM5 N/A No comparator variants at the same amino acid residue (Gly248) with a different amino acid change were identified. PM5 candidate harvesting returned zero same-residue candidates, and ClinVar contains no entries for any variant at residue 248.

PM6 Not met No de novo data available for this variant. No family-based studies or trio analyses have been performed. No literature reports a de novo occurrence of c.743G>C.
PP1 Not met No co-segregation data available. No family pedigree or segregation analysis has been performed for this variant.
PP2 Not met RB1 is a tumor suppressor gene where truncating variants (nonsense, frameshift, splice-site, large deletions) account for >80% of pathogenic germline variants (PMID:42461076). Missense variants comprise only 9.2% of pathogenic germline variants and are not a common disease mechanism for RB1. The variant does not meet the PP2 criterion requiring missense variants to be a common mechanism of disease in a gene with a low rate of benign missense variation.
PP3 Not met Multiple in silico predictors do not support a deleterious effect. REVEL score is 0.272 (below the commonly used 0.5 threshold for pathogenicity). BayesDel score is -0.129 (negative, indicating benign). SpliceAI max delta score is 0.01 (no predicted splicing impact). The weight of computational evidence does not support PP3.

PP4 Not met No patient phenotype or family history data are available. The variant was assessed in isolation without clinical context; PP4 requires a highly specific phenotype or family history for the disease.
PP5 Not met This variant is absent from ClinVar. PP5 requires a reputable source (e.g., ClinVar expert panel) to have classified the variant as pathogenic; no such classification exists.

BA1 Not met This variant is absent from gnomAD v2.1, v4.1, and gnomAD-Canada. The allele frequency of 0% does not meet the BA1 threshold of >1%.

BS1 Not met This variant is absent from gnomAD v2.1, v4.1, and gnomAD-Canada. The allele frequency of 0% does not meet the BS1 threshold of >0.3% under generic non-VCEP rules.

BS2 Not met No observation data in healthy adult controls are available. BS2 requires the variant to be observed in a healthy adult individual for a disorder with full penetrance expected at an early age, which cannot be assessed without such data.
BS3 Not met No well-established functional studies demonstrating no deleterious effect are available for this variant. OncoKB reports Unknown Oncogenic Effect. No published experimental data characterize the functional consequence of p.Gly248Ala.

BS4 Not met No segregation data available. BS4 requires lack of co-segregation with disease in affected family members; no family studies have been performed for this variant.
BP1 Not assessed RB1 is a gene in which >80% of pathogenic germline variants are truncating (nonsense, frameshift, splice-site, large deletions). Missense variants account for only 9.2% of pathogenic variants (PMID:42461076). The variant c.743G>C is a missense change in a gene where the primary disease mechanism is loss of function through truncating variants, satisfying BP1 at supporting benign strength.
BP2 Not met No data on whether this variant has been observed in trans with a known pathogenic variant. BP2 requires observation in trans with a pathogenic variant in a recessive disorder or in cis with a pathogenic variant in a dominant disorder, which cannot be assessed without phase data.
BP4 Met Multiple lines of computational evidence suggest no deleterious effect. REVEL score is 0.272 (benign range, below 0.5 threshold). BayesDel score is -0.129 (negative, benign prediction). SpliceAI max delta score is 0.01 (no splicing impact, well below 0.2). Three independent in silico predictors concur on a benign or non-deleterious prediction, satisfying BP4 at supporting benign strength.

BP5 Not met This variant is absent from ClinVar. BP5 requires a reputable source to have classified the variant as benign; no such classification exists.

BP6 Not met This variant is absent from ClinVar. BP6 requires a reputable source to have classified the variant as benign; no such classification exists.

BP7 N/A This is a missense variant (c.743G>C, p.Gly248Ala), not a synonymous variant. BP7 applies only to synonymous variants with no predicted splice impact.
